A Google Earth Engine–Based Framework for Dynamic Urban Heat Island Analysis Using Landsat 8/9 (2015–2025): Case Study of Leverkusen, Germany

Overview

Dynamic analysis identifies annual urban heat island patterns, suggesting important tools for climate adaptation.

Key Points

  • This research aims to develop a framework for monitoring urban heat islands using Landsat imagery over a decade.
  • Utilized Landsat 8 and 9 imagery from 2015 to 2025
  • Estimated land surface temperature with a single-channel algorithm
  • Defined UHI zones using a dynamic threshold based on mean LST and standard deviation
  • Tracked annual UHI patterns effectively in Leverkusen, Germany
  • Provided a practical tool for monitoring urban heat trends
  • Supported strategies for climate adaptation and sustainable urban planning
